Custodial - Environmental Services Assistant Manager
Position Overview
The Environmental Services Assistant Manager will work with the Environmental Services Manager to coordinate and oversee operations to fulfill contractual and organizational responsibilities effectively. This role involves leading a diverse team, ensuring compliance with cleanliness and sanitation standards, and fostering a positive and inclusive work environment.
Responsibilities
Operational Leadership: Plan, supervise, and manage daily operations for both daytime guest services and evening custodial shifts. Oversee sanitation standards across all areas, ensuring cleanliness and compliance with organizational policies. Adjust work schedules to optimize workflow and meet operational demands.
Team Management: Train, and evaluate team members while ensuring compliance with safety and operational standards. Provide feedback, and support employee development. Foster an inclusive, respectful, and diverse team environment.
Training and Compliance: Develop and implement custodial training programs for safe and effective equipment use. Ensure team compliance with federal, state, and local regulations. Promote sustainability initiatives across multiple teams.
Collaboration and Communication: Partner with other departments to align services with established goals and standards. Maintain positive relationships with internal and external stakeholders. Communicate policies and procedures effectively, both verbally and in writing.
Budget and Resource Management: Manage supply inventory and ensure maintenance of stock and equipment. Event Support: Assign and supervise event setup, monitoring, and teardown. Ensure event spaces and public areas are clean and well-maintained.
